Kiel University Opens New Marine Science Campus: A Hub of Knowledge and Collaboration

Kiel University has taken a significant step in advancing marine research with the opening of its new Marine Science Campus on February 12. This initiative brings together scientists, technology, and society to study oceans, coastal ecosystems, and sustainable marine resource management.

A Center for Interdisciplinary Research

Located in Oskar-Heil-Haus, the campus was established as part of the Kiel Marine Science (KMS) priority program. Its mission is to strengthen interdisciplinary connections between research groups and foster public engagement.

The new center houses:

  • The KMS headquarters

  • The FYORD program, focused on supporting early-career researchers

  • The Centre for Ocean and Society (CeOS), which explores the impact of oceans on human life

  • The Kiel University Digital Office, integrating cutting-edge technology into marine research

State-of-the-Art Laboratories and New Frontiers in Science

The campus is equipped with advanced facilities for studying marine risks, climate change, and sustainable resource management. Key laboratories include:

  • VAMPIR – A calibration lab for precise measurements of water and atmospheric parameters

  • CeOS Visualization Lab – A research space for simulating marine processes and natural disasters

Science for Everyone: Events and Lectures

One of the campus’s core missions is to make knowledge accessible to the public. Planned activities include:

  • Networking events for scientists and students

  • Public lectures on marine ecosystems and climate change

  • Workshops to enhance public understanding of oceanic processes

Rapid Implementation of an Ambitious Vision

The transition from the university council’s decision to establish a unified marine research center to the relocation of the first research teams took just one year. This reflects Kiel University’s commitment to integrating science, technology, and education.
